Transparency and Accountability
One of the primary ethical considerations when employing AI in cryptocurrency development revolves around transparency. The use of AI can often act as a ‘black box’, where decision-making processes are not easily understood by human observers. In the context of cryptocurrencies, where stakeholder trust is paramount, ensuring that AI algorithms are designed to be transparent is crucial. Developers must provide comprehensible insight into how AI systems make decisions, especially in automated trading and asset management systems.
Accountability is also closely tied to transparency. Who is responsible if an AI-driven recommendation leads to significant financial loss? Distributing accountability across stakeholders can dilute responsibility. Therefore, it’s imperative for developers and organizations to establish clear guidelines defining accountability for AI actions, fostering a culture of shared responsibility.
Data Privacy and Security
Incorporating AI into cryptocurrency projects often necessitates the handling of vast amounts of data. This can include personal information, transaction histories, and behavioral data. Ethical considerations around data privacy and security are, therefore, paramount. The collection and utilization of such data must conform to stringent privacy regulations, such as the General Data Protection Regulation (GDPR) in Europe.
Developers should ensure that any data collected is minimally invasive; only the essential data required for the functioning of the AI algorithms should be harvested. Additionally, smart contracts and decentralized protocols should prioritize user anonymity and consent, ensuring ethical data use and maintaining users’ trust.
Mitigating Bias in AI Algorithms
Bias in AI algorithms is a significant concern within any industry, including cryptocurrency. AI systems trained on historical data can inadvertently perpetuate existing biases, which can lead to unfair advantages or disadvantages for specific groups of users. In the cryptocurrency realm, where financial access is often unequal, any bias can exacerbate these inequalities.
To mitigate bias, developers must deploy diverse datasets that represent various demographics, ensuring that the AI can make equitable decisions. Regular algorithm auditing and the implementation of bias detection frameworks are essential practices that can help in maintaining fairness throughout the development process.
Environmental Considerations
Cryptocurrencies, particularly those relying on proof-of-work consensus mechanisms, have come under fire for their significant energy consumption. Integrating AI into cryptocurrency development could escalate these energy demands if not managed responsibly. Ethical considerations must prompt developers to seek solutions, such as optimizing algorithms to minimize energy use or supporting the transition toward eco-friendly blockchain technologies like proof-of-stake.
Furthermore, developers should transparently disclose the environmental impact of their AI systems and cryptocurrency operations, thereby allowing users to make informed decisions that align with their values regarding sustainability.
